Rack Mounting

The ADC1 USB is part of Benchmark's ½-wide
System1™ product family. Each is one rack
unit high and is exactly ½ the width of a
standard 19" rack panel.
System1™ products have rack-mount holes
that are machined to conform to standard
rack-mount dimensions. Two ½-wide
System1™ units may be joined together to
form a single rigid 19" panel that can be
installed in any standard 19" rack.
Either ear of a ½-wide System1™ device can
be mounted directly to a standard 19" rack.
A Rack Mount Coupler connects the other ear
to a ½-wide Blank Rack Panel or another ½-
width System1™ product
Tip: Use the rack-mount screws supplied with
the DAC1 USB (or screws with plastic
washers) to avoid scratching the surface of
the faceplate.

Rack Mount Coupler

The Rack Mount Coupler is a machined
aluminum junction block that joins any two
½-wide System1™ devices for rack mounting.
It is also used to join a Blank Rack Panel to
a single ½-wide System1™ device.

Blank Rack Panel

The Blank Rack Panel is a ½-wide 1-RU
aluminum panel for mounting a single ½-wide
System1™ device in a standard 19" rack.
Installation requires one Rack Mount Coupler.
